How much does a Speech Language Pathologist make in Galveston, TX?
Speech Language Pathologists (SLPs) in Galveston, TX, enjoy a competitive salary. On average, they make about $97,721 per year. This is a good income for those in the field of healthcare and rehabilitation.
SLPs in Galveston can earn between $67,290 and $155,000 annually. The most common salaries fall between $75,264 and $131,079. A range of factors, including experience and education, can impact the final salary. Most SLPs with a few years of experience earn closer to the mid-range, while those with more experience earn towards the higher end.
